Duties of the HGV Trailer Technician:

  • Conduct inspections, servicing, and repairs on HGV trailers
  • Lifting Deck and Tail Lift experience
  • Diagnose and repair Electronic Braking System (EBS) faults
  • Complete all compliance and maintenance documentation accurately
  • Follow health and safety regulations diligently
  • Attend training courses to enhance technical expertise and stay updated with industry standards

Candidate Criteria for the HGV Trailer Technician role:

  • Proven experience working with Lifting Deck and Tail Lift experience for vehicles
  • Industry recognised qualifications such as City & Guilds or NVQs in automotive or trailer maintenance
  • Ability to work efficiently in a high-paced environment while maintaining high-quality standards
  • IRTEC accreditation (desirable but not essential)
  • Experience with EBS diagnostics (Knorr Bremse, Haldex, WABCO)
  • Welding certifications (desirable)
  • Knowledge of axle manufacturers such as BPW, SAF, JOST
  • Experience with tail lift and double-deck trailer maintenance
